Ordinals
beta
Address 1Nq6rCatzhinqTBA68edjMzoArqoJrhVdC
sat balance
22655914
outputs
4db7583a7ee697e71bf480f0648e3cf3eb1ba412e975cf5b1ceaefc79b4408d3:1